Common Misconceptions About the Travis County District Clerk
Many people hold misconceptions about the Travis County District Clerk’s role and services. Clarifying these misunderstandings can help users navigate resources more effectively.
1. Misconception: The District Clerk’s Office Only Handles Criminal Cases
Many individuals believe that the Travis County District Clerk’s Office is solely focused on criminal matters. In reality, this office manages a broad range of cases, including civil, family, and probate law. This misconception often arises from the prominence of criminal trials in media coverage. Users seeking information on civil lawsuits, divorce filings, or guardianship proceedings may overlook the clerks’ valuable resources and documentation related to these areas.
2. Misconception: Information is Inaccessible to the Public
A common belief is that records maintained by the Travis County District Clerk are not publicly available. Contrary to this notion, many documents are accessible to the public, either online or in person. The office provides a variety of services, including public records searches and online databases, making it easy for residents to find vital information such as court filings, case statuses, and legal notices. Understanding this transparency can empower citizens to utilize the available tools more effectively.
3. Misconception: The Office Can Provide Legal Advice
Another frequent misconception is that the staff at the Travis County District Clerk’s Office can offer legal counsel. While the office can assist with procedural questions and provide necessary forms, they are not legally authorized to give legal advice. It’s essential for individuals seeking guidance on their specific legal situations to consult a qualified attorney. This distinction helps ensure that individuals receive appropriate support and avoid relying on incorrect information.

Common Mistakes Users Make with the Travis County District Clerk Website
When utilizing the Travis County District Clerk’s website for various services like document retrieval, case lookup, or record access, users often encounter pitfalls that can lead to frustration and inefficiencies. Here are some common mistakes and how to avoid them.
1. Incorrect Case Number Entry
Mistake Explanation: A frequent issue arises when users input incorrect case numbers, either by misreading information or typing errors. This can happen due to the similar formatting of different case numbers or outdated records.
Actionable Solution: Double-check the case number against the original document or confirmation you received. Additionally, utilize features on the Travis County District Clerk website that allow for the retrieval of cases by other identifiers, such as names or dates, if you’re uncertain about the case number.
2. Failure to Understand Public Access Limitations
Mistake Explanation: Many users mistakenly assume that all records available through the Travis County District Clerk’s website are public and accessible. However, some documents may have restricted access due to privacy concerns or ongoing investigations.
Actionable Solution: Before beginning a search, review the website’s guidelines on public access. Familiarize yourself with the types of documents that are available online versus those that require in-person requests or additional permissions. This can save time and reduce frustration.
